BOPIS (Buy Online, Pick Up In Store) is a retail fulfillment strategy that allows customers to place orders through an online store and collect their purchases at a nearby physical store location. This method bridges the gap between ecommerce and traditional in-store retail, enabling faster delivery times and added convenience.
Retailers use existing store infrastructure to fulfill orders. This reduces shipping costs and draws customers into stores. More in-store visits can lead to additional sales.
BOPIS supports a seamless shopping experience, by connecting digital and physical retail, meeting the demand for convenience. Additionally, similar fulfillment strategies like click-and-collect, store fulfillment, and curbside pickup are gaining popularity globally for their flexibility and efficiency in meeting customer needs.

BOPIS is vital in today’s retail environment because it aligns with consumer demands for flexible and convenient shopping. It gives retailers a competitive advantage by driving traffic to physical stores, reducing last-mile delivery costs, increasing upsell opportunities during pickup, and enabling a personalized customer experience. The fast, convenient service fosters trust and loyalty, encouraging repeat business, while enhancing brand reputation through a seamless shopping experience.

Yes. Advances in cloud-based retail platforms and scalable technology have made BOPIS more accessible than ever. Even retailers with limited store networks can adopt modular solutions for inventory management, associate task execution, and customer communication.
Low-cost mobile devices, intuitive dashboards, and simplified integration options allow smaller businesses to stay competitive with larger companies.
